The Sage The Perfect Press is designed for home cooks who prioritize texture and consistency in their toasted sandwiches, utilizing an innovative pressure-control hinge that prevents the internal contents from being crushed. This 1500W stainless steel appliance is perfect for creating cafe-style results with crispy exteriors and fluffy interiors, though users should be aware that it is optimized specifically for sandwiches and lacks versatile attachments for grilling or waffle making.

FAQs

Can I use this to grill vegetables or meats?

No, this unit is specifically designed for sandwiches and does not feature the open-grill settings or temperature control required for cooking raw proteins.

What is the wattage of the Sage The Perfect Press?

This model features a powerful 1500W heating element.

Can I use metal tongs to remove my sandwich?

We do not recommend using metal utensils as they can damage the non-stick coating. Use silicone or wooden tools instead.

How many sandwiches can I make at once?

The press is designed to accommodate up to two sandwiches per session.

Is the stainless steel housing difficult to clean?

The stainless steel housing is quite durable and can be kept clean by wiping it down with a damp, soft microfiber cloth after the unit has cooled.

Does this unit require a specific voltage?

It is designed for standard AC input voltage of 220 - 240 V.

Troubleshooting

Unit does not heat up when plugged in

Ensure the power cord is fully inserted into the wall outlet and check that the outlet is receiving power.

Bread is sticking to the plates

Ensure the non-stick plates are cleaned thoroughly of all residue; you may lightly brush the plates with a tiny amount of cooking oil before the next use.

Indicator light not turning on

If the unit is warm but the light remains off, the light may be faulty; contact Sage support for professional assessment.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setting up the unit involves ensuring it is placed on a flat, heat-resistant surface with adequate ventilation space on all sides. Before the first use, wipe the plates with a damp cloth to remove any dust. When cooking, allow the unit to preheat until the indicator light signifies it is ready.

For care and maintenance, always allow the press to cool completely before cleaning. Because of the non-stick surface, avoid using metal utensils that could scratch the coating; silicone or wooden tools are recommended. Simply wipe the plates with a soft cloth and warm, soapy water; never immerse the unit in water.
